Transaction 585a6e446da7263a5528e0c0dfef920f9b285d485c7f7c42e6172482808777a5
1 Input
1 Output
-
585a6e446da7263a5528e0c0dfef920f9b285d485c7f7c42e6172482808777a5:0
- value
- 4988635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a80ce936d9178f8f47973267434421874e86e5e OP_EQUAL
- address
- 3CrkfcL8Qb645aoDTWS8BVNGqnL4Huo4SP